body { font-family: "Meiryo", "Yu Gothic", sans-serif; background-color: #f2f2f2; color: #2e2e2e; line-height: 1.9; max-width: 760px; margin: 3em auto; padding: 1em; } h1 { font-size: 1.9em; margin-bottom: 1em; color: #e85c00; text-align: left; } h2 { font-size: 1.3em; margin-top: 2.2em; margin-bott…